Unbeatable location
It was our 3rd time in NY so we had had plenty of experience with hotels. The hotel is small but you don't need anything bigger or fancier in NY since you don't spend much time in the hotel. The staff working there were very polite and took the time to answer some questions we had. They took care of our transport reservations and made us feel welcomed. Even though our room was small, it was very, very clean and tidy. The shower was great and quite big which is what mattered the most. However, the bed was not comfortable at all. The location was unbeatable (between 5th and 6th Avenue), all sights, restaurants, Central Park and the shops were within short distance. However, if you want to walk to Chelsea, Soho or the Meatpacking District, it is a 45-minute walk. But that's ok since NY is enjoyable. Our experience was pleasant and we would like to return to that hotel.

Average 3* hotel
For a 4 star hotel as Mansfield claims to be I cannot give it more than 2 stars. For a 2 star hotel, in this location I would've given it a 5 star rating. My wife and I stayed here for 10 nights in a Chambre Queen (during Christmas and New Year). The location is great - on 5th Av., 5 minutes from TImes Square. The room size is average - about the same size as other boutique hotels or even larger than 3 star boutique hotels in Paris. However, the bathroom sink is way to small. If you try to wash your face you'll find yourself in a big puddle. The bathroom wasn't very small so I don't know why they chose such a small basin. They have dark brown hardwood floors that absorb all the light so that's why people found this a bit dark. The lighting however is sufficient. The TV in the room is actually a DELL display with a TV tuner attached. I've seen reviews mentioning the fact that they offer free coffee and tea in the lobby. Yes, this is true - however most 3+ star hotels would have a coffee/tea machine in the room. This one doesn't so every morning you need to go downstairs to get the coffee. It's probbly ok in the winter but in the summer I'd rather walk to one of the many coffee shops in the area if I can't get a coffee in my room. The staff is friendly when you arrive but afterwards they NEVER said hello (at least in the 11 days I've been there) when passing by. I don't usually ask for directions or interact with the staff however I do expect to be greeted. If you do have an issue they are very responsive so no complain there (I actually had to call them a couple of times). The biggest problem however and this is something that I want to emphasize is the fact that there is NO way to control the temperature in the room during winter. All 3+ stars hotels have some sort of temperature control. The heat comes from a very small radiator that's controlled centrally. And while our room was very cold (we had to ask for 3 blankets) the next door guests had to keep their windows open because it was too hot. For the summer all rooms have a window AC unit - however that's useless in the winter as it only provides cooled air. Overall I would recommend this hotel for short stays but only if you get a very good deal. This is nowhere near a 4 star hotel but if you can get it cheaper than a 3 star hotel in the area go for it.
